Memorial Project Nha Trang, Vietnam- 'Towards the Complex-For the Courageous, the Curious and the Cowards
The 'Memorial Project Nha Trang Vietnam (2001)' is a video project done by Jun Nguyen-Hatsushiba. This video shows 3 cyclos getting pulled by two men for each cylco under the Nha Trang Bay. The reason why Jun wanted to make a video on something like this was to show the culture of the country slowly fading away into the modern western world. He used the cylcos as an example to show that this once prosperous way of transportation is now slowly fading into a tourist attraction and how it relates to the country slowly becoming more 'Westernized'.
It also features 30 mosquito nets which was set amongst the coral in the bay. What this symbolized a pilgrimage or a place of offering to the drivers of the cyclos. Jun also tells that the cyclo drivers or who carry people on their cyclos for a living would be pushed or put into a 'complex' situation of trying to find ends meet. Jun also says the nets should represent rest, repose, security, comfort, social and historical boundaries.
